Beyond the translation

Overall song meaning

The song is a lighthearted, conversational kuthu song featuring a debate between two friends regarding love versus alcohol. One side argues cynicism about modern romance, pointing out how relationships often start at trendy spots like Coffee Day and lead to heartbreak at TASMAC bars, claiming girls treat love as a temporary pastime. The opposing side defends romantic love as divine, eternal, and transformative, comparing the heart without love to a trash can.

Writing craft

Poetic devices

Simile (Uwamai)

Ithu koranga pola nadikkum

Compares desire/alcohol intoxication to monkey-like unstable behavior (Ithu koranga pola nadikkum).

Metaphor (Uruvagham)

Empty-aana idhayam oru kuppa serum thottiyinu

Compares an empty, loveless heart to a trash bin (Empty-aana idhayam oru kuppa serum thotti).

Rhyme / Assonance (Monai & Etukai)

Coffee day-il thodaraum kadhal / Tasmac-ula mudiyudhu

Usage of matching initial/second consonant sounds across lines like 'Coffee Day-il' and 'Tasmac-ula'.

Allusion

Rendaiyum kattruthandha namma dhevadaasu

Refers to Devadas, the legendary tragic romantic character, as the master who taught both love and liquor culture.
